×

169.254.x.x 是什么 IP?APIPA 自动私有地址、DHCP 失败与网络故障排查指南

如果你的电脑、打印机、服务器或摄像头突然拿到 169.254.x.x,这通常不是一个“正常配置好的网络地址”,而是一个故障信号。 在 Windows、部分 Linux 设备和某些嵌入式终端里,当网卡已经起来、但 DHCP 分配失败时,系统会自动回退到 169.254.0.0/16 这段链路本地地址,也就是常说的 APIPA。

这意味着问题往往不在公网,也不在“IP 归属地”,而在本地网络:网线、交换机端口、VLAN、DHCP 服务、网关配置或终端自身网卡状态都可能是根因。

169.254.x.x APIPA 与 DHCP 故障排查

169.254.x.x 是什么地址?

169.254.0.0/16 是链路本地 IPv4 地址段。最常见的使用场景是:设备原本应通过 DHCP 拿到办公网、家庭网或生产网里的正常地址,但由于 DHCP 过程失败,系统自动给自己分配了一个 169.254.x.x 地址,以便在极小范围内做本地链路通信。

这类地址并不适合正常的跨网段访问,也不应该作为你生产网络里长期存在的正常地址。很多时候,一旦看到它,就应该先想“DHCP 出问题了没有”。

APIPA 是什么?

APIPA 是 Automatic Private IP Addressing 的缩写,常被翻译成“自动私有 IP 地址分配”。它不是管理员手工规划出来的网段,而是终端在拿不到 DHCP 地址时的自动回退行为。Windows 环境里最常见,很多运维和桌面支持场景里都把“拿到 169.254 地址”直接等同于“DHCP 没成功”。

169.254.x.x 出现时通常代表什么

为什么设备会拿到 169.254.x.x?

  • DHCP 服务器宕机或服务未启动
  • 交换机端口 VLAN 配错,DHCP 请求没到正确网段
  • 网线、模块、网卡或交换机端口存在物理层故障
  • 网关或三层接口异常,导致地址池不可达
  • 网络里有异常 ACL、广播隔离或安全策略拦住了 DHCP

核心判断很简单:网卡链路可能是通的,但地址获取流程没有完成。所以它和“完全断网”不完全一样,比完全断网多了一点线索。

169.254.x.x 出现时通常会有什么症状?

  • 电脑能看到网卡已连接,但上不了网
  • 只能访问极少数同链路设备,跨网段访问失败
  • ipconfig 或系统网络设置里显示 169.254 开头地址
  • 默认网关为空,或者网关不可达
  • 打印机、摄像头、PLC 或 NAS 突然“离线”

第一步该查什么?

  1. 先确认物理链路:网线、交换机端口、光模块、PoE 供电是否正常。
  2. 再确认交换机 VLAN:终端所在端口是否进了正确业务网段。
  3. 查看 DHCP 服务:地址池是否耗尽、服务是否存活、Relay 是否正常。
  4. 检查网关和三层接口:DHCP Server 或 Relay 所在路径是否通。
  5. 如果是单设备问题,再看本机网卡驱动、静态配置残留或防火墙策略。

169.254.x.x 和正常私网地址有什么区别?

地址类型常见含义是否正常生产分配
192.168.x.x常见家庭或办公私网
10.x.x.x企业或大规模私网
172.16.x.x - 172.31.x.x私网地址段
169.254.x.xAPIPA / DHCP 失败后的自动回退通常不是

排障时哪些命令最有用?

ipconfig /all
ipconfig /release
ipconfig /renew
ping 127.0.0.1
ping 默认网关
arp -a

示例 APIPA 地址:
169.254.1.0    169.254.1.1    169.254.1.2    169.254.1.3    169.254.1.4
169.254.1.5    169.254.1.6    169.254.1.7    169.254.1.8    169.254.1.9
169.254.1.10    169.254.1.11    169.254.1.12    169.254.1.13    169.254.1.14
169.254.1.15    169.254.1.16    169.254.1.17    169.254.1.18    169.254.1.19
169.254.1.20    169.254.1.21    169.254.1.22    169.254.1.23    169.254.1.24
169.254.1.25    169.254.1.26    169.254.1.27    169.254.1.28    169.254.1.29
169.254.1.30

如果 ipconfig /renew 后仍然回到 169.254.x.x,基本可以确认 DHCP 流程没有成功闭环。

常见误区

1. 169.254.x.x 是公网 IP 吗?
不是,它不是公网可路由地址。

2. 169.254.x.x 是正常办公网地址吗?
通常不是,它更像是故障回退结果。

3. 只要换网线就一定能解决吗?
不一定。物理层只是第一步,VLAN、DHCP、网关路径也同样常见。

4. 能不能先手工配一个静态地址顶上?
可以临时验证链路,但如果不解决 DHCP 根因,问题还会重复出现。

结论

169.254.x.x 最常见的意义不是“这是某种特殊正常网段”,而是“设备没拿到 DHCP 地址,系统回退到了 APIPA”。 真正的排查重点通常是物理链路、交换机 VLAN、DHCP 服务和网关路径,而不是 IP 属地本身。